Boosting Efficiency: Business Operations Software Use Case Examples
Business operations software has become vital for companies of all sizes looking to streamline processes and boost productivity. These versatile solutions offer a range of features designed to automate tasks, improve collaboration, and gain valuable insights into business performance.
Here are some compelling use case examples that illustrate the effectiveness of business operations software:
* **Inventory Management:** Software can manage inventory levels in real time, reducing waste and ensuring efficient delivery to customers. This results in improved customer satisfaction and reduced costs associated with storage and stockouts.
* **Customer Relationship Management (CRM):** CRM systems consolidate customer data, providing a comprehensive view of interactions. Businesses can use this information to personalize interactions, build stronger relationships, and boost sales.
* **Project Management:** Project management software helps teams plan, track, and execute projects more productively. Features like task assignment, progress tracking, and collaboration tools facilitate project workflows, keeping everyone on the salon management software same page.
* **Financial Management:** Accounting software automates tasks such as invoicing, expense tracking, and financial reporting. This frees up time for businesses to focus on core initiatives and improves financial accuracy.
By implementing the right business operations software, companies can transform their operations, leading to increased efficiency, profitability, and overall success.
